A1: TEFL (Teaching English as a Foreign Language) concentrates on mentor English to non-native speakers in nations where English is not the primary language. TESOL (Teaching English to Speakers of Other Languages) is a wider term that encompasses both TEFL and TESL (Teaching English as a Second Language), which is focused on mentor English in nations where it is spoken.
